How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fentress?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fentress Studio Apartments | $1,557 | $1,044 | $2,454 |
| Fentress 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,116 | $686 | $1,615 |
| Fentress 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,348 | $670 | $2,009 |
| Fentress 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,638 | $660 | $2,631 |
Fentress 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,469 | $499 | $2,855 |

Largest Available Fentress and Nearby 4 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 4 Bedroom apartment unit in Fentress, TX is found at Millbrook Commons in the San Marcos neighborhood and is 2,380 square feet priced from $2,655. Redwood has the second largest 4 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,919 square feet and currently listed start at $1,487. Here is today’s list of the largest available 4 Bedroom units in Fentress: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Millbrook Commons | Grand Canyon | 2,380 Sq Ft | $2,655 |
| Redwood | D1 | 1,919 Sq Ft | $1,487 |
| Sunset Point | Mason | 1,832 Sq Ft | $2,504 |
| Riverstone | 4 Bedroom | 1,620 Sq Ft | $1,499 |
| Lockhart Farms | 4 Bed - D1 | 1,519 Sq Ft | $1,499 |
Cheapest Available Fentress and Nearby 4 Bedroom Apartments
As of July 30, 2026 the lowest priced 4 Bedroom apartment unit in Fentress, TX is the D1 Model starting from $1,465 at Mission Trail at El Camino Real in the San Marcos neighborhood. The second most affordable Fentress 4 Bedroom is the D1 Model at Redwood starting at $1,487 . The average price for all 4 Bedroom apartments in Fentress is currently $1,469.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 4 Bedroom options in Fentress: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Mission Trail at El Camino Real | D1 | $1,465 |
| Redwood | D1 | $1,487 |
| Lockhart Farms | 4 Bed - D1 | $1,499 |
| Riverstone | 4 Bedroom | $1,499 |
| Centro35 | D2 | $1,649 |
